Диференціал проти криптоаналізу: різниця та порівняння

Ключові винесення

  1. Диференціальний криптоаналіз аналізує, як відмінності вхідних даних впливають на вихідні дані.
  2. Криптоаналіз — це загальне дослідження зламу алгоритмів шифрування.
  3. Диференціал - це статистичний підхід, криптоаналіз використовує ряд методів.

Що таке диференціал?

Диференціал відноситься до техніки, яка використовується для аналізу поведінки криптографічних алгоритмів або протоколів, зокрема в області криптографії з симетричним ключем.

Диференціальний криптоаналіз є потужним методом, який використовують криптоаналітики для зламу криптографічних систем, особливо блокових шифрів. Він зосереджений на спостереженні за відмінностями (або диференціалами) у вхідних і вихідних даних криптографічної функції, коли до вхідних даних вносяться невеликі зміни.

Диференціальний криптоаналіз є складною та складною технікою, яка вимагає глибокого розуміння та значних обчислювальних ресурсів. Протягом багатьох років він успішно застосовувався для зламу кількох криптографічних алгоритмів. У результаті розробники криптографії повинні бути обережними щодо використання надійних засобів захисту від диференціальних атак під час проектування та аналізу криптографічних систем.

Що таке криптоаналіз?

Криптоаналіз — це дослідження аналізу та зламу криптографічних систем з метою пошуку слабких місць або вразливостей в алгоритмах, які використовуються для захисту конфіденційної інформації. Криптоаналіз має на меті виявити секретний ключ або іншу конфіденційну інформацію, яка дозволяє несанкціонований доступ до зашифрованих даних або комунікацій.

Криптоаналіз є важливою областю для оцінки безпеки криптографічних систем. Виявляючи та розуміючи потенційні недоліки, криптоаналітики та криптографічні дизайнери можуть покращити безпеку алгоритмів і протоколів, зробивши їх більш стійкими до атак і забезпечивши захист конфіденційних даних.

Також читайте:  Квебекська французька проти французької французької: різниця та порівняння

Різниця між диференціальним і криптоаналізом

  1. Диференціал відноситься до конкретної техніки в рамках криптоаналізу, яка передбачає вивчення відмінностей (диференціалів) у вхідних і вихідних даних криптографічної функції або алгоритму. Криптоаналіз, з іншого боку, є більш широкою областю, яка охоплює різні методи та техніки для аналізу та зламу криптографічних систем, не обмежуючись лише диференціальними методами.
  2. Основною метою диференціального криптоаналізу є виявлення та використання диференціальних характеристик у криптографічному алгоритмі для потенційного відновлення секретного ключа. Криптоаналіз має на меті зламати систему шифрування або криптографічну систему, щоб отримати неавторизований доступ до зашифрованих даних, незалежно від конкретної техніки, яка використовується.
  3. Ця методика в основному застосовується до криптографічних алгоритмів із симетричним ключем, особливо до блокових шифрів. Криптоаналіз можна застосовувати до різних криптографічних систем, включаючи як симетричні, так і асиметричні схеми шифрування, криптографічні протоколи та хеш-функції.
  4. Диференціальний криптоаналіз передбачає аналіз ймовірності виникнення певних відмінностей та ідентифікацію слідів диференціальних характеристик. Криптоаналіз використовує широкий спектр методів, включаючи атаки грубою силою, частотний аналіз, алгебраїчні атаки, атаки по бічних каналах, атаки за допомогою вибраного відкритого тексту тощо.
  5. Диференціальний криптоаналіз — це спеціалізований і передовий криптоаналітичний метод, який вимагає глибокого розуміння криптографічного алгоритму та значних обчислювальних ресурсів. Криптоаналіз охоплює більш широкий спектр атак, починаючи від базових і простих методів і закінчуючи складними математичними та обчислювальними підходами.

Порівняння між диференціальним і криптоаналізом

Параметри порівнянняДиференціальнийКриптоаналіз
ВизначенняТехніка криптоаналізу, яка передбачає вивчення відмінностей (диференціалів) у вхідних і вихідних даних криптографічної функції або алгоритму.Визначайте та використовуйте диференціальні характеристики для відновлення секретного ключа в симетричних криптографічних алгоритмах.
Основна метаВ основному застосовується до криптографічних алгоритмів із симетричним ключем, особливо до блокових шифрів.Зламайте систему шифрування або криптографічну систему, щоб отримати несанкціонований доступ до зашифрованих даних або конфіденційної інформації.
ЗастосовністьВ основному застосовується до криптографічних алгоритмів із симетричним ключем, особливо до блокових шифрів.Застосовується до широкого діапазону криптографічних систем, включаючи як симетричне, так і асиметричне шифрування, криптографічні протоколи та хеш-функції.
Методи, що використовуютьсяАналіз диференціальних ймовірностей та визначення проб диференціальних характеристик.Атаки грубою силою, частотний аналіз, алгебраїчні атаки, атаки з бічних каналів, атаки за допомогою вибраного відкритого тексту тощо.
складністьСпеціалізована та вдосконалена криптоаналітична техніка вимагає глибокого розуміння криптографічного алгоритму та значних обчислювальних ресурсів.Охоплює спектр атак, починаючи від базових і простих методів і закінчуючи складними математичними та обчислювальними підходами.
посилання
  1. https://link.springer.com/chapter/10.1007/978-3-030-17653-2_11
  2. https://link.springer.com/chapter/10.1007/978-3-642-38348-9_24
Також читайте:  Газлайтинг проти брехні: різниця та порівняння

Останнє оновлення: 25 листопада 2023 р

крапка 1
Один запит?

Я доклав стільки зусиль для написання цього допису в блозі, щоб надати вам користь. Це буде дуже корисно для мене, якщо ви захочете поділитися цим у соціальних мережах або зі своїми друзями/родиною. ДІЛИТИСЯ ЦЕ ♥️

Залишити коментар

Хочете зберегти цю статтю на потім? Клацніть сердечко в нижньому правому куті, щоб зберегти у власній коробці статей!